Inversion injuries of the ankle are common, and result in ankle sprain … WebApr 3, 2024 · Ankle injury is a ubiquitous problem seen commonly in all minor injuries units and Emergency departments. Presentation may be the result of a relatively minor trip, or following a more significant traumatic precipitant. Assessment Following ankle trauma, the two main differential diagnoses are of a ligamentous injury (ankle sprain) and a fracture.

WebInversion. An inversion sprain is the most common and occurs when the ankle turns in or out and the ligament on the outside of your ankle tears. Trips and falls cause inversion sprains. External rotation. An external rotation injury tears the ligament between the fibula and tibia, known as the syndesmosis ligament.
